The Fraternity & Sorority Life Graduate Assistant supports the Coordinator for Fraternity & Sorority Life in planning and implementing student activities programs and leadership development programs for chapters and their members. The Graduate Assistant also supports the development of all FSL educational programming through individual advising, tracking and maintaining organization data and records, offering training and resource materials, managing marketing strategies and materials, attending pertinent meetings, etc.
This position begins in June at a summer hourly pay of $15/hr and transitions in fall/winter semesters to stipend pay of $4,500/semester, equally distributed in 17 pay periods through April 2027.
- Co-advise the National Pan-Hellenic Council (NPHC), Multicultural Greek Council (MGC), Interfraternity Council (IFC), and College Panhellenic Association (CPA) in all endeavors and activities to promote learning, values congruence, risk management, and personal and organizational development.
- Co-advise the Order of Omega and Gamma Sigma Alpha honor societies.
- Help plan and implement leadership programs including New Member Institutes, Council Retreats, and Presidents Retreats.
- Keep FSL records, database, and website updated and accurate.
- Complete and compile statistics, semester grade reports, and other community data as assigned.
- Network within EMU and the surrounding community to create opportunities for civic engagement and facilitate these opportunities for chapters through training, support, networking and reflection activities.
- Assist in the planning and facilitation of community initiatives and events.
- Assist in the annual AFLV Awards Assessment Process with NPHC, MGC, CPA, and IFC officers.
- Develop collaborative relationships with various University offices and organizations.
- Create an awareness of Campus Life resources and opportunities.
- Implement EMU and Campus Life policies and procedures, including: student organization registrations, constitutions, and disseminating campus rules and regulations (Student Organizations Handbook and Student Code).
- Supervise two undergraduate student assistants.
- Fulfill other duties as assigned to support Fraternity & Sorority Life and other Campus Life programmatic efforts (e.g. Eagle Fest, Homecoming, Campus Life Staff Retreat, etc.).
